For example, when the enum std ioctl returns the PAL standard it returns PAL_BG|PAL_DK|PAL_H|PAL_I. When setting the norm, it required the bitmask to match exactly the set of norms used during the enumeration. If just one norm was specified, for example PAL_BG or NTSC_M, it would fail. This violates the V4L2 spec, "VIDIOC_S_STD accepts *one* or more flags..." The key thing to realize is that V4L2_STD_PAL is not one bit, it is multiple bits. It's ok to call S_STD with any *one* of those bits, but the driver was requiring *all* of them. This fixes the S_STD function so that it will accept any set of one or more PAL norms as PAL, and the same for NTSC and SECAM. Signed-off-by: Trent Piepho Acked-by: Ronald S. It also wasn't looking in the right spot. It was looking at the file handle's copy of the buffer status, rather than the driver core copy. The interrupt routine marks frames as done in the driver core copy, the file handle copy isn't updated. So even if poll() looked at the right frame, it would never see it transition to done and return POLLIN. The compressed capture code has this same problem, looking in fh->jpg_buffers when it should have used zr->jpg_buffers. There was some logic to detect when there was no current capture in process nor any frames queued and try to return an error, which ends up being a bad idea. It's possible to call select() from one thread while no capture is in process, or no frames queued, and then start a capture or queue frames from another thread. The buffer state variables are protected by a spin lock, which the code wasn't acquiring. That is fixed too. Signed-off-by: Trent Piepho Acked-by: Ronald S. If capture was turned back on, the driver would think this frame was currently being captured, and wait for it to complete before starting a new frame. The hardware on the other hand would not be actively capturing a frame. The result was the driver would wait forever for v4l_grab_frame to be captured. Some calls to zr36057_set_memgrab(0) were missing spin-locks, which have been added. Signed-off-by: Trent Piepho Acked-by: Ronald S.
